Asset Liquidation of Russian Oil Giant Holdings Before US Sanctions Take Effect
International oil refineries and additional holdings of Russian company Lukoil are appealing to prospective purchasers as the deadline approaches to arrange discounted transactions before American restrictions are implemented on November 21st.
International Asset Sales
The Kazakh state firm KazMunayGas is considering a purchase for Lukoil's Kazakh operations, according to insiders with knowledge.
Shell has demonstrated curiosity in Lukoil's offshore holdings in West African nations, various insiders confirmed.
State Acquisition
The government of Moldova has started talks to acquire Lukoil's infrastructure at Moldova's main air terminal.
Bulgaria is working towards confiscating and liquidating Lukoil's Burgas refinery, although national leadership have demanded revisions to the proposed law.
In Egypt, Lukoil has indicated to the administration its possible plans to sell out, according to insiders.
Strategic Dilemma
The company confronts either selling its assets and having the funds possibly confiscated, or their takeover by international governments if it does not sell them.
Industry experts suggest Lukoil may try to follow Russian oil firm Rosneft, whose European operations were put under external management in 2022.
